Tacos and Tequila Arriving Soon at Fashion Valley - Eater San Diego

"The first of two new Fashion Valley eateries from Fox Restaurant Concepts will make its debut later this month; scheduled to grand open on Wednesday, September 26, Blanco Tacos + Tequila will bring a modern Mexican menu and a big tequila-based beverage program to the mall. This is the fourth Blanco location for the highly-regarded hospitality group, run by True Food Kitchen founder Sam Fox, which also operates Flower Child in Del Mar and will launch North Italia at Fashion Valley later this year and a yet-unnamed eatery in Coronado in early 2019. Located on the second floor of the mall near the movie theater, Blanco Tacos + Tequila seats 225 across a 4,930-square-foot indoor/outdoor space; the design for the San Diego outpost is new for the brand, and includes unique artwork and murals. It will be open daily for lunch and dinner, with a weekday happy hour from 3 p.m. to 6 p.m. Executive chef Aimee Patel is overseeing a menu that starts with a signature guacamole made with roasted poblano, anaheim chiles, caramelized onion, and cotija cheese and other dishes including chicken tortilla soup, warm queso dip, and “Mexican pizza” topped with short rib machaca. Tacos are the centerpiece, served on fresh corn tortillas, with fillings ranging from grilled avocado to Snake River Wagyu carne asada, but there are also burritos, bowls, enchiladas, and fajitas. Beverages get equal billing, from agave spirits for sipping to cocktails made with fresh juices that include a Blackberry Clementine Margarita with white tequila and hibiscus sea salt to a Oaxacan Shandy made with pineapple, blood orange liqueur, tequila, Mexican beer and cilantro." - Candice Woo
